A life insurance contractual provision protects the beneficiary by not permitting the insurer to introduce outside information to deny payment of the claim.Such outside information might be notes that the agent took while the insured completed the application.This contractual provision is the


A) entire contract clause.
B) incontestable clause.
C) reinstatement clause.
D) change-of-plan provision.
